Proshots Indoor Range & T is a facility in Clemmons, NC that offers indoor shooting ranges for firearms enthusiasts to practice their marksmanship skills in a controlled environment.
With a focus on safety and skill development, Proshots Indoor Range & T provides a space for individuals to hone their shooting abilities and enjoy the sport of shooting.
Generated from their business information